Cooking instructions

Instructions for 2 [for 3] [for 4] portion recipe.

1.

Preheat the oven to 220°C/ 200°C (fan)/ gas 7

Chop your potatoes (skins on) into bite-sized pieces

Add the chopped potatoes to a baking tray (or two!) with a drizzle of olive oil and a pinch of salt and pepper

Give everything a good mix up and put the tray[s] in the oven for an initial 18 min

Step 1
2.

Pat your salmon fillet[s] dry with kitchen paper

Add half your ground smoked paprika (save the rest for later!) to a plate with a pinch of salt and pepper and mix it together

Add the salmon fillet[s] to the plate and turn until fully coated, then set aside – these are your smoky salmon fillet[s]

Step 2
3.

Chop your cherry tomatoes in half

Step 3
4.

Trim, then chop your green beans in half

Step 4
5.

After the initial 18 min, remove the tray[s] from the oven

Add the chopped tomatoes and chopped green beans to the tray[s] with a drizzle of olive oil

Sprinkle over the remaining ground smoked paprika and give everything a good mix up

Step 5
6.

Add the smoky salmon fillet[s] to the tray[s] with a drizzle of olive oil

Return the tray[s] to the oven for a further 14-15 min or until the fish is cooked through, the potatoes are crisp and the vegetables have softened – this is your smoky salmon tray bake

Tip: Your fish is cooked once it turns opaque and flakes easily

Step 6
7.

Meanwhile, combine your mayo and harissa paste (can't handle the heat? Go easy!) in a small bowl and mix it all together – this is your harissa mayo

Step 7
8.

Serve the smoky salmon tray bake with the harissa mayo drizzled over the top

Enjoy!
